Latest Patents

Guenther's latest patents revolve around a dual pump arthroscopic irrigation/aspiration system with outflow control. This advanced fluid pump system features a first fluid pump designed to transport fluid from a source to a surgical site. Concurrently, a second fluid pump effectively removes fluid from the surgical site at a first predetermined rate. Notably, this innovative system can operate in conjunction with a surgical tool that extracts fluid at a second predetermined rate, which is greater than the first. The system also incorporates a sensor that monitors a specific parameter of the surgical tool, providing an output signal that indicates the tool’s operation. An actuating mechanism, responsive to this output signal, actuates the second fluid pump to enhance fluid removal at the elevated rate as needed.
